Noun syndoulos (fellow slave) in the Gospels-Acts

(Translation from NRSV)


Matthew

18: 28But that same slave, as he went out, came upon one of his fellow slaves (syndoulos) who owed him a hundred denarii; and seizing him by the throat, he said, 'Pay what you owe.'
18: 29Then his fellow slave (syndoulos) fell down and pleaded with him, 'Have patience with me, and I will pay you.'
18: 31When his fellow slaves (syndoulos) saw what had happened, they were greatly distressed, and they went and reported to their lord all that had taken place.
18: 33Should you not have had mercy on your fellow slave (syndoulos), as I had mercy on you?'
24: 49and he begins to beat his fellow slaves (syndoulos), and eats and drinks with drunkards,
